Subject: kill filter-branch --remap-to-ancestor?
Date: Sat, 21 Aug 2010 20:32:37 +0000 (UTC) [thread overview]
Message-ID: <i4pd55$19q$1@dough.gmane.org> (raw)
I had some headache with the issue to which the cure is the "--remap-to-ancestor" option of git filter-branch -- back when "--remap-to-ancestor" was not yet (cf. http://thread.gmane.org/gmane.comp.version-control.git/112068/focus=112838).
This time, in a similar situation, I had some headache with finding out that the panacea is already there and it's called "--rema
p-to-ancestor".
Why not cut back on complexity and get rid of "--remap-to-ancestor" while automatically enable the implied behavior for filters including a path? This was already proposed by Junio and the author of the option had no objections against this idea (see
http://thread.gmane.org/gmane.comp.version-control.git/130949/focus=132684).
